Window Replacement in Conservation Areas
Parts of Shoreditch fall within conservation areas where external alterations and standard double glazing are restricted. In these cases we recommend secondary glazing, an internal system that delivers measurable improvements in thermal and acoustic performance without changing the building’s external appearance. This is particularly relevant for period frontages and listed buildings where planning controls apply.

Boarding Up in Shoreditch
When a window, door or shopfront cannot be reglazed immediately, boarding up provides essential temporary security. Our boarding up service is available across Shoreditch and the surrounding areas for shops, bars, offices and homes.
We fit Oriented Strand Board (OSB) or marine ply, depending on the level of protection required, directly into the existing frame to maintain as much structural integrity as possible while the replacement glass is prepared. For commercial premises, we can also install temporary door panels and sub-frames where the original frame has been damaged, then return to complete the permanent glazing once the replacement units are ready. What Types of Glass Do We Install in Shoreditch?
SGC Glass fabricates and installs a wide range of glass types suited to Shoreditch’s mix of commercial frontages, converted warehouses and residential conversions:
- Laminated anti-bandit glass holds together when broken and resists forced entry, making it the standard choice for shopfronts and ground-floor commercial frontages where security is a priority.
- Toughened safety glass is required in low-level glazing, doors, partitions and any area classified under the Building Regulations as a critical location.
- Acoustic glass uses a specialist laminated interlayer to reduce noise transmission, which suits Shoreditch premises on busy frontages or near the area’s bars and nightlife.
- Fire-rated glass provides certified protection against the spread of smoke and fire, and is installed strictly in line with its tested configuration to maintain its rating in commercial and mixed-use buildings. You can read more about our fire rated glazing.
- Double and triple glazed units with warm-edge spacer bars and low-emissivity coatings improve thermal performance and reduce condensation, manufactured to current energy standards.
